    Default Frustrated with erratic behavior

    We have been experiencing unexplained errors with our ShopBot since we got it. At first we thought we were making mistakes that caused our issues. As we get more comfortable using the software and machine, we are becoming more and more frustrated with what seems to be random and erratic behavior.

    1. When resuming a toolpath after pausing, the spindle dives into the table and begins an unexplained move. This has happened when simply pausing and resuming AND after entering a "nudge" value although it does not always happen.
    2. When doing a 3D offset, the z raises to 4" (when started from 1") before starting the aircut. This happens every time we do a 3D offset.


    Our shopbot PRS alpha has the lastest control software. I have talked with a few support engineers but no one has been able to provide an answer.

    Issue #1 is an annoyance and causes problems when using thick material and/or a long bit as the z-axis will top out and error forcing a re-zeroing of Z.

    We have snapped a number of bits as a result of issue #2 and tonight we dove right through our spoilboard leaving a gash that will require replacing the entire sheet.

    Is anyone else experiencing things like this? Have you been able to find and fix the issue? I should be able to reliably pause and restart a file without risking my bit or my vacuum table.

    What version of software are you running? Know you say latest, but want to check if it's the latest production version or the beta or ?

    Issue 1, I have seen in previous versions but have not encountered it lately. I stop and resume often, but don't much use the nudge feature.

    Issue 2, using the 3d offset feature of the FP command is not one I believe very many folks use. Most of us do this in our design software these days. It would help here if you could provide the first hundred lines or so of your program, and what you are entering into the FP fillin sheet for offsets and proportions.

    Thanks for the responses.

    Control Software Version: 3.6.44
    Partworks 3 Software Version: 3.504
    Home Position in Partworks 3: X:0 Y:0 Z:0.8
    Clearance in Partworks 3: 0.2
    Plunge in Partworks 3: 0.2

    Partworks 3D Software Version: 1.002
    Rapid Clearance Gap: .25

    I offer the settings from both partworks and partworks 3D because we have had issue #1 happen with files coming from both. Again, this is an intermittent problem but the bottom line is that I am never comfortable pausing a file anymore.

    Ken, regarding issue #2, we instruct our users to do a 3D offset "aircut" before running their file to be sure they have done their tool paths correctly. The only thing we change in the fill in sheet is the option for the offset. I instruct users to move the tool to 0,0,1 before loading the part for the aircut (as long as the cuts they are doing are less than 1" deep).

    As an experiment, you might try zeroing your Z above the material for your aircuts instead of using the 3d offset and see if it makes any difference.

    For an aircut, I move my z an inch above my material, then do a ZZ, then run the toolpath as normal (no 3d offset).

    This might tell us if there is a problem in the Offset portion of the control software.
